Latest Patents
Jialiang Liu holds a patent for a method titled "Method for preparing electrode film layer on surface of solar cell substrate." This patent describes a process that involves obtaining a metal electrode material melt by heating and melting the material under vacuum conditions. The method further includes bombarding the metal electrode material melt with an ion source at low energy, allowing it to be sputtered and deposited on the surface of the solar cell substrate. This process results in the formation of an electrode film layer, with the energy of low energy bombarding ranging from 30 eV to 80 eV. He has 1 patent to his name.
